Is your League of Legends client acting up? Don't worry, you're not alone! A lot of players experience issues with their client from time to time. Whether it's crashing, freezing, or just plain not working, it can be super frustrating. But the good news is that most of these problems can be fixed with a few simple steps. This guide will walk you through the most common solutions to get you back in the game in no time. Let's dive in, guys, and get your League client running smoothly again!

    Common Issues and Quick Fixes

    Before we get into the more detailed solutions, let's cover some quick fixes that might solve your problem right away. These are the easiest and fastest things to try, so start here!

    • Restart Your Client: This might seem obvious, but it's often the most effective solution. Close the League of Legends client completely and then reopen it. Sometimes, a simple restart is all it takes to clear up temporary glitches.
    • Restart Your Computer: If restarting the client doesn't work, try restarting your computer. This can help resolve issues with your system that might be affecting the client. A fresh reboot can clear up memory issues and background processes that could be interfering with the game.
    • Check Your Internet Connection: Make sure you have a stable internet connection. A poor connection can cause the client to freeze or crash. Try restarting your router or connecting to a different network to see if that resolves the issue. You can also run a speed test to check your internet speed and stability.
    • Run League of Legends as Administrator: Running the game as an administrator can give it the necessary permissions to function correctly. Right-click on the League of Legends shortcut and select "Run as administrator." This can bypass permission-related issues that might be causing problems.

    If none of these quick fixes work, don't worry! We've got more advanced solutions coming up. Let's move on to troubleshooting the League of Legends client itself.

    Repairing the League of Legends Client

    If the quick fixes didn't do the trick, it's time to try repairing the League of Legends client. The client has a built-in repair tool that can automatically detect and fix corrupted files or other issues. Here’s how to use it:

    1. Open the League of Legends Client: Launch the client as you normally would.
    2. Go to Settings: Click on the gear icon in the top-right corner of the client to open the settings menu.
    3. Click "Repair": Look for the "Repair" button in the settings menu. It might be under a specific tab, like "General" or "Troubleshooting." Click on it to start the repair process.
    4. Wait for the Repair to Finish: The repair process can take some time, depending on the extent of the damage and the speed of your computer. Be patient and let it run its course. Don't interrupt the process, as this could cause further issues.
    5. Restart Your Client: Once the repair is complete, restart the League of Legends client and see if the issue is resolved. Hopefully, this will get you back in the game without any more problems!

    What Does the Repair Tool Do?

    You might be wondering exactly what the repair tool does behind the scenes. Here's a breakdown:

    • File Verification: The repair tool scans all the game files to ensure they are the correct version and haven't been corrupted.
    • Automatic Correction: If the tool finds any damaged or missing files, it automatically downloads and replaces them with fresh copies from the Riot Games servers.
    • Configuration Reset: In some cases, the repair tool might reset your client settings to their default values. This can help resolve issues caused by incorrect or corrupted settings.

    The repair tool is a powerful and convenient way to fix many common client issues. If you're having trouble with your League of Legends client, it's always a good idea to try the repair tool first. It could save you a lot of time and effort compared to other troubleshooting methods.

    Updating Your Graphics Drivers

    Outdated or corrupted graphics drivers can cause a variety of issues with the League of Legends client, including crashes, freezes, and graphical glitches. Keeping your drivers up to date is crucial for ensuring a smooth gaming experience. Here's how to update your graphics drivers:

    1. Identify Your Graphics Card: First, you need to know what graphics card you have. You can find this information in the Device Manager on Windows, or in the System Information on macOS.
    2. Download the Latest Drivers: Visit the website of your graphics card manufacturer (NVIDIA, AMD, or Intel) and download the latest drivers for your card. Make sure to download the correct drivers for your operating system.
    3. Install the Drivers: Run the driver installer and follow the on-screen instructions. It's usually a good idea to choose the "Clean Install" option, which will remove any old drivers before installing the new ones.
    4. Restart Your Computer: After the installation is complete, restart your computer to apply the changes. This is important to ensure that the new drivers are loaded correctly.

    Why Are Graphics Drivers Important?

    Graphics drivers are the software that allows your operating system and games to communicate with your graphics card. They are responsible for rendering images on your screen and ensuring that everything looks smooth and correct. When your drivers are outdated or corrupted, they can cause a variety of problems, including:

    • Crashes and Freezes: Outdated drivers can cause the game to crash or freeze unexpectedly.
    • Graphical Glitches: You might see weird textures, flickering, or other graphical anomalies.
    • Poor Performance: Outdated drivers can reduce the game's performance, causing it to run slowly or jerkily.

    Keeping your graphics drivers up to date is one of the most important things you can do to ensure a smooth and enjoyable gaming experience. Make it a habit to check for updates regularly, especially when a new game is released or when you're experiencing graphical issues.

    Reinstalling League of Legends

    If none of the above solutions work, it might be necessary to reinstall League of Legends completely. This is a more drastic step, but it can often resolve issues that are caused by corrupted or missing game files. Here's how to do it:

    1. Uninstall League of Legends: Go to the Control Panel on Windows or the Applications folder on macOS and uninstall League of Legends.
    2. Delete Remaining Files: After uninstalling the game, there might be some residual files left behind. Go to the installation directory (usually C:\Riot Games\League of Legends on Windows) and delete any remaining files or folders.
    3. Download the Latest Installer: Visit the League of Legends website and download the latest installer for the game.
    4. Install League of Legends: Run the installer and follow the on-screen instructions. Make sure to choose a location with enough free space on your hard drive.
    5. Update the Game: After the installation is complete, launch the League of Legends client and let it download any necessary updates. This can take some time, depending on your internet connection.

    When Should You Reinstall?

    Reinstalling League of Legends is a good option when:

    • You've tried all other solutions and nothing has worked.
    • You're experiencing persistent crashes or errors.
    • You suspect that your game files are corrupted.

    Reinstalling the game can be a time-consuming process, but it's often the only way to fix certain issues. If you're having trouble with your League of Legends client, don't hesitate to give it a try. It could be the solution you've been looking for!

    Checking Firewall and Antivirus Settings

    Sometimes, your firewall or antivirus software can interfere with the League of Legends client, preventing it from connecting to the game servers or causing other issues. Here's how to check your firewall and antivirus settings:

    1. Check Your Firewall Settings: Make sure that League of Legends is allowed through your firewall. You might need to add the game's executable file (LeagueClient.exe) to the list of allowed programs.
    2. Check Your Antivirus Settings: Some antivirus programs can mistakenly flag League of Legends as a threat. Check your antivirus settings and make sure that the game is not being blocked or quarantined.
    3. Temporarily Disable Your Firewall or Antivirus: As a test, you can temporarily disable your firewall or antivirus software to see if that resolves the issue. If it does, you'll need to adjust your settings to allow League of Legends to run properly.

    Why Do Firewalls and Antivirus Programs Interfere?

    Firewalls and antivirus programs are designed to protect your computer from threats, but they can sometimes be overly aggressive and block legitimate programs. League of Legends requires a stable internet connection to communicate with the game servers, and if your firewall or antivirus program is blocking that connection, it can cause a variety of issues.

    It's important to keep your firewall and antivirus software enabled to protect your computer from threats, but you also need to make sure that they're not interfering with your games and other programs. Take the time to configure your settings properly to ensure a smooth and secure gaming experience.

    Contacting Riot Games Support

    If you've tried all of the above solutions and you're still having trouble with your League of Legends client, it's time to contact Riot Games Support. They have a team of experts who can help you troubleshoot more complex issues. Here's how to contact them:

    1. Visit the Riot Games Support Website: Go to the Riot Games Support website and log in with your League of Legends account.
    2. Submit a Ticket: Click on the "Submit a Ticket" button and choose the appropriate category for your issue. Be sure to provide as much detail as possible about the problem you're experiencing, including any error messages you're seeing.
    3. Wait for a Response: A Riot Games Support agent will review your ticket and respond to you as soon as possible. Be patient, as it can take some time to get a response, especially during peak hours.

    What Information Should You Include in Your Ticket?

    When you submit a ticket to Riot Games Support, be sure to include the following information:

    • A detailed description of the issue you're experiencing.
    • Any error messages you're seeing.
    • The steps you've already taken to try to resolve the issue.
    • Your computer's specifications (operating system, graphics card, etc.).

    The more information you provide, the better equipped the support agent will be to help you resolve your issue. Don't be afraid to include screenshots or videos to illustrate the problem you're experiencing.

    Conclusion

    Fixing your League of Legends client can be a frustrating experience, but with a little patience and the right troubleshooting steps, you can usually get back in the game in no time. Start with the quick fixes, then move on to the more advanced solutions, and don't hesitate to contact Riot Games Support if you need help. Good luck, and have fun on the Rift! Remember, guys, stay positive and keep trying – you'll get there eventually! And, most importantly, don't forget to have fun playing League of Legends!